Dog Skin Condition Red. We often call these symptoms ‘dermatitis’. Hot spots (moist dermatitis) are patches of red, infected skin, they appear very quickly, look wet and often weep. Dermatitis is a common yet uncomfortable skin condition in dogs, marked by itching, inflammation, and irritation. Hot spots (technically known as acute moist dermatitis or pyotraumatic dermatitis) are red, inflamed areas that can seem to appear overnight. “skin that appears red, inflamed, or irritated could signal an allergic reaction or infection,” says nicole savageau, a veterinarian.
